Support Policy
The practical boundaries of standard AI1Host support and the responsibilities that come with self-managed hosting.
1. Self-managed service model
Unless a service description expressly says otherwise, AI1Host hosting is self-managed. We operate the hosting platform and core services; customers manage their websites, applications, content, mailboxes, users and day-to-day configuration.
2. What standard support includes
- Platform faults and availability issues.
- Account access, activation and basic platform guidance.
- Billing, renewal, security and abuse queries.
- Reasonable help identifying whether a fault is platform-related or within customer-managed software.
3. What standard support does not include
- Building, editing or administering websites.
- Debugging custom code, themes, plugins or third-party applications.
- Search optimisation, content work, training or consultancy.
- Guaranteed recovery of customer data or repair of compromised websites.
Additional work may be quoted separately where available.
4. Making a useful support request
Use the ticket or email route and include the affected service or domain, when the problem began, exact errors, recent changes and steps already tried. Please mask passwords and other secrets. “It’s broken” is emotionally valid, but technically rather underpowered.
5. Priorities and response targets
Requests are prioritised by impact rather than arrival order alone. Current definitions and initial response targets are set out in the Support Policy & Service Levels.
6. Responsibilities
AI1Host is responsible for maintaining the platform and core services. Customers are responsible for their data, applications, updates, credentials, configurations and suitable backups, except where a specific service description states otherwise.
7. Reasonable and respectful use
Support usage must be reasonable and communications must remain respectful. Excessive or specialist work may require a paid service or different plan. Abuse towards staff may lead to restrictions or suspension.
